Manual transmission/final drive oil level, 
checking
 
     
5-speed manual transmission 012/01W  
     
Special tools and equipment  
     
Key 3357, or
     Hex key socket attachment, 17 mm AF
     
Note:  
     The vehicle must be absolutely horizontal when 
checking transmission oil level. This work is 
best performed over an inspection pit or using a 
four column lifting platform. 
     The prescribed oil level is to be adhered to 
exactly; the transmission reacts very sensitively 
to over-filling. 
     The oil filter plug is on the left of the 
transmission below the speedometer sender; it 
may be concealed by the heat shield for the 
drive shaft. 
    
Depending on the version installed, use either special tool 3357 or a 
17 mm hex socket key to loosen the oil filter plug.

CAUTION! 
If the oil level is below the specified area, check the transmission for 
leaks. It is not sufficient to top up with oil. 
CAUTION! 
Part numbers are for reference only. Always check with your Parts 
Dept. for the latest parts information.  -  To check oil level, unscrew oil filler plug (arrow).
-  Check oil level with locally manufactured tool, e.g. a piece of angled 
wire. 
Specification: oil level 7 mm below bottom edge of oil filler hole 
-  If transmission has no leaks, top up with gear oil: SAE 75 W 90 
(synthetic oil), part number G 052 145 S2 (1 liter). 
-  Install oil filler plug.
-  Tighten oil filler plug to 25 Nm.

6-spd. manual transmission 01E all wheel 
drive  
     
Note:  
     
For checking oil level the vehicle must be 
stationary and on a level surface (e.g engine 
off, standing on an alignment lift). 
     The oil level must be kept at the specified level. 
The transmission may be damaged by over-
filling. 
    
CAUTION! 
If the oil level is too low, the transmission must be checked for leaks 
and repaired. It is not sufficient to just top off oil. 
CAUTION! 
Part numbers are for reference only. Always check with your Parts 
Dept. for the latest parts information.  -  Remove filler plug -B-, on differential cover, in front of drive axle flange.
-  Check oil level using tool such as angled wire.
   Specification: level 1 mm below bottom of oil filler hole.
-  If there are no leaks, top up with gear oil: SAE 75 W 90 (synthetic oil), 
part number G 052 145 S2 (1 liter).

Automatic Transmission Fluid (ATF), 
checking (01V transmission)
 
     
Requirements for check:  
     
Vehicle standing on level surface. 
     Transmission must not be in fail-safe mode. 
     Shift lever in "P" position, parking brake 
applied. 
     Engine idling. 
     Air Conditioner and heater OFF. 
     ATF temperature must not exceed 40 C 
(104 F) at start of test. 
     
CAUTION! 
     
Part numbers are for reference only. Always 
check with your Parts Dept. for the latest 
parts information. 
     
Notes:  
     
Only ATF with designation ESSO LT 71 141

may be used. Do not use any lubricant 
additives. 
     Automatic transmission fluid: ATF, part 
number G052 162 A2 (1 liter) 
     An ATF level check when transmission oil 
temperature is too low results in overfilling; 
when too high results in underfilling.

CAUTION! 
     
Too much or too liffle ATF will affect the 
operation of the transmission. The ATF level 
must be checked at regular intervals. 
    
The oil level is correct if only a slight amount of oil runs out when ATF 
temperature is between 30 C (86 F) and 45 C
1) (113 F) (caused by 
increase of oil level when heated).  
WARNING! 
Wear protective glasses. 
    
The ATF temperature is measured temperature using the VAG 1551 Scan 
Tool.  -  Hang filled ATF reservoir VAG 1924 as high as possible (example: 
radiator grill). 
-  Shift lever in "P", engine running at idle.
-  Place oil drip pan under transmission oil pan.
-  Connect VAG 1551 as described on   Page 19
 .
-  Press key -1- for " Rapid Data Transfer " mode.

-  Press keys -0- and -2- to select address code -
02- "Transmission Electronics", and confirm with 
key -Q-. 
     
- 
Press   key to advance program.     
-  Press keys -0- and -8- to select address code -
08- "Read Measuring Value Block' and confirm 
with key -Q-. 
     
-  Press keys -0- and -4- to select address code -
04- "Display Group Number", and confirm with 
key -Q-. Read measurin
g value block 
1
1 2 3 4
    
- 
Display shows ATF temperature (in  C) appears in measuring value 
block 1. 
    
1) For warmer climates, 50 C (122 F).   -  Remove ATF filler plug -2-.
- 
With ATF temperature between 30 C (86 F) and 45 C
1) 
(113 F
1)) a 
slight amount of fluid will flow from filler hole when ATF level is correct. 
-  If necessary drain or top off ATF to attain correct fluid level.
-  Top off ATF with filler hook from VAG 1924 ATF reservoir.
-  Insert VAG 1924 ATF reservoir filler hook into filler hole and top off until 
a slight amount of fluid flows from filler hole.

Note:  
     Fit filler hook into one of the oil deflector cap -4- 
slots placed on the filler opening. 
     
CAUTION! 
     
Do not press filler hook upward or oil 
deflector cap can be pushed off. 
     
-  Reinstall ATF filler plug -2-.
     
 
Tightening torque: 80 Nm (59 ft lb).
     
- 
Press   key to advance program.
     
-  Press keys -0- and -6- to select address code -
06- "Data Transmission Ended" and confirm with 
key -Q-.
